Transaction 861a84a763fdcc18b2eb7c7fdcb1e2ac7a82eeb81006bee36744e5ded3f28809
1 Input
1 Output
-
861a84a763fdcc18b2eb7c7fdcb1e2ac7a82eeb81006bee36744e5ded3f28809:0
- value
- 151355
- script pubkey
- OP_0 OP_PUSHBYTES_32 1be71694900cc7522d1aeb19620fef9667cad5912fa7957b713a311cf55f5181
- address
- bc1qr0n3d9yspnr4ytg6avvkyrl0jenu44v397ne27m38gc3ea2l2xqsmlrnae